Valletta is Malta's compact Baroque capital and the island's primary event hub. The city hosts more upcoming events than anywhere else on the island — from the Malta Jazz Festival at the Grand Harbour waterfront to the Eco Festival at the Floriana Granaries and Isle of MTV on the open-air Granaries stage.
The city's fortified walls, Baroque churches and UNESCO World Heritage status make it an exceptional backdrop for outdoor performances. Most major events take place between June and September, with the Grand Harbour amphitheatre and the open-air squares filling up fast.
Top Valletta events in summer 2026
- Isle of MTV Malta 2026 (21 Jul) — free outdoor concert at the Floriana Granaries; the largest free music event in Malta.
- Malta Jazz Festival (6–11 Jul) — six nights of jazz at the Grand Harbour waterfront and Ta' Liesse, with international soloists and ensembles.
- Eco Festival 2026 (1 Jul) — sustainability, food and culture at the Valletta bastions.
- Opera in the Capital 2026 (27 Jun) — classical opera at a Valletta venue.
- Notte Italiana (6–7 Aug) — Italian music and culture evenings in the capital.

- What is there to do in Valletta in summer 2026?
- The headline events are Isle of MTV (free, July), Malta Jazz Festival (July) and the Eco Festival (July). The historic streets, St John's Co-Cathedral, the Grand Harbour and Upper Barrakka Gardens are all walkable from each other.
- Is Isle of MTV in Valletta free?
- Yes — Isle of MTV Malta is held at the Floriana Granaries adjacent to Valletta and is free to attend. Crowds are very large so arrive early.
